Tile damage repair services involve addressing issues such as cracked, chipped, loose, or broken tiles in various parts of a property. The process typically includes removing damaged tiles, preparing the surface, and installing new tiles that match the existing ones. Skilled service providers may also perform grout and sealant replacement to ensure the repaired area maintains its appearance and durability. This service helps restore the aesthetic appeal of tiled surfaces while preventing further deterioration that could lead to more extensive repairs.
These services are essential for resolving common problems associated with tile damage, such as water infiltration, mold growth, and structural weakening. Cracked or loose tiles can pose safety hazards and lead to water leaks that damage underlying surfaces. Repairing damaged tiles helps prevent these issues from escalating, thereby extending the lifespan of tiled surfaces in both residential and commercial properties. Proper repair also maintains the integrity of areas like kitchens, bathrooms, entryways, and outdoor patios.

Tile Damage Repair Costs - Repair costs for tile damage typically range from $150 to $600 depending on the extent of the damage and tile type. Minor cracks or chips may be on the lower end, while extensive replacement can increase costs.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details.
Material and Tile Type - The cost of repairing tile varies with the material, with ceramic repairs often costing between $200 and $500, while natural stone repairs may range from $300 to $700. The type of tile influences both material costs and labor complexity.
Repair Method and Scope - Small repairs such as filling cracks or replacing individual tiles generally cost between $100 and $300. Larger repairs involving extensive replacement or resurfacing can range from $400 to $1,000 or more, depending on the area.
Location and Service Provider - Costs can vary based on local market rates in Belton, MO, and surrounding areas. Contacting local tile repair professionals can help obtain accurate estimates tailored to specific damage and project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of tile damage can be repaired? Local tile repair professionals can address issues such as cracks, chips, broken tiles, and grout damage to restore the appearance and functionality of tiled surfaces.
How long does tile damage repair typically take? Repair times vary depending on the extent of the damage, but most projects can be completed within a few hours to a day by local service providers.
Is it possible to match the existing tile during repair? Yes, experienced tile repair specialists often source matching tiles or use similar materials to ensure repairs blend seamlessly with the existing surface.
Can damaged tiles be repaired or do they need to be replaced? Minor damage may be repairable, but severely broken or cracked tiles often require replacement to ensure durability and appearance.
How can I prevent future tile damage? Proper installation, regular maintenance, and avoiding impact or heavy loads can help prevent future tile damage, with guidance from local tile repair experts.
